![nosql manager for mongodb nosql manager for mongodb](https://img-blog.csdnimg.cn/20190410190044925.png)
- #Nosql manager for mongodb update
- #Nosql manager for mongodb software
- #Nosql manager for mongodb code
Limitations concerning document size: You can’t have documents in MongoDB that are larger than 16 MB.It doesn’t have well-defined relations, which causes duplication of data. Duplication of data: MongoDB isn’t an RDBMS (Relational Database Management System).Failing to do so can considerably degrade the performance. Requires high expertise: Do you want excellent performance from MongoDB? You need the right expertise to implement the indexes well.These factors combine to increase the usage of memory. This DBMS (Database Management System) stores key names for each value pairs. A high degree of memory usage: As we discussed, MongoDB provides limited support for “Joins”.
#Nosql manager for mongodb code
You need to write your own code to implement “Joins”, furthermore, it can adversely impact the performance. Developers working on improving MongoDB are currently working on this.
#Nosql manager for mongodb update
The lack of support for transactions: Are you creating an application that requires transactions? Do you plan to update multiple documents or collections using transactions? MongoDB doesn’t support this, and you could encounter corrupt data.MongoDB has a few disadvantages, which are as follows: It provides robust technical support, furthermore, there’s community support available. Support: MongoDB provides excellent documentation.It provides query support, which includes ad-hoc queries. Querying capabilities: MongoDB is a feature-rich database management system.You will find its JavaScript-based client easy for queries. Ease of use: You can set up MongoDB easily.This helps you to deal with large data sets since you can distribute them to multiple servers. Scalability: MongoDB allows horizontal scaling.It offers very useful features like load balancing, replication, etc. Availability: You can use MongoDB as a file system, which is called “GridFS” (Grid File System).This enables faster access to documents, and speed is a key advantage of MongoDB. Speed: MongoDB allows you to index documents.You can just distribute them to different servers. It allows you to store large sets of data. Sharding: MongoDB supports sharding, which is a useful technique for partitioning.You can store any type of data in separate documents, which offers flexibility.
![nosql manager for mongodb nosql manager for mongodb](https://kolompc.com/wp-content/uploads/2018/01/NoSQL-Manager.jpg)
#Nosql manager for mongodb software
As a document database, MongoDB stores data in JSON-like documents.ġ0gen, a software company started developing MongoDB in 2007.
![nosql manager for mongodb nosql manager for mongodb](https://www.softwaretestinghelp.com/wp-content/qa/uploads/2022/01/nosqlmanager.png)
It’s a general-purpose database that’s document-based. MongoDB is one of the most popular NoSQL databases. After explaining their pros and cons, we compare them. We first provide overviews of all of these NoSQL databases. Which NoSQL database should you use? Our MongoDB vs Cassandra vs Redis vs Memcached vs DynamoDB comparison can help you to decide. Many projects require NoSQL databases in addition to relational databases. A comparison between popular NoSQL databases: MongoDB vs Cassandra vs Redis vs Memcached vs DynamoDBĪs an entrepreneur or an enterprise IT project manager, you likely think about databases to use in your application development projects.